How do you type a superscript on a Mac?
Typing Subscript & Superscript Text in Mac OS X
- Pull down the “Format” menu and go to “Font”
- Select the “Baseline” submenu and choose either “Superscript” or “Subscript”
- Type the desired text to be subscripted or superscripted, then go back to the same menu and choose “Use Default” to return to normal baseline text.

How do you superscript in Keynote?
Keynote –
- Making Text Subscript or Superscript.
- To make selected text subscript or superscript: Choose Format > Font > Baseline > Subscript.
- To raise or lower the selected text incrementally: Choose Format > Font > Baseline > Raise.
- To restore selected text to the baseline: Choose Format > Font > Baseline > Use Default.

How do you subscript in Google Docs on a Mac?
How to insert a superscript or subscript in Google Docs using keyboard shortcuts
- Superscript: In Windows, press Ctrl + . (Ctrl and the period key). On a Mac, it’s Command + .
- Subscript: In Windows, press Ctrl + , (Ctrl and the comma key). On a Mac, that’s Command + , (Command and the comma key).

How do you write subscript and superscript in overleaf?
Overleaf – LaTeX: Mathematics in LaTeX
To produce text in superscript, use a caret followed by the text you want in superscript in curly brackets. To write text as a subscript, use an underscore followed by the text in curly brackets. The symbol “&” on its own is used as part of a code in LaTeX.
